The DNA test reports of rape-accused Shiney Ahuja have confirmed that the Bollywood actor had physical relationships with his teenaged maid who had alleged that the film star had raped her, a police official said here Monday.
u00a0
"We have received the test reports and they confirm the allegations made by the victim in the police complaint against the accused," Amitabh Gupta, Additional Police Commissioner of Mumbai (North Region) told. However, Gupta declined to comment further in the matter.
u00a0
Independent sources said that the DNA samples of the accused matched the samples taken from the 18-year-old victim, who had also suffered scratch marks on her body.
u00a0
Investigators had also taken samples of other articles from Shiney's residence in the posh Versova area of Andheri west for evidence, including semen stains detected there.
u00a0
The development comes a week after Shiney's blood sample reports had nailed his claim that he was drunk when he was accused of raping his domestic help.
u00a0
The blood sample report also clearly mentioned that he was not drunk and was in his full senses at the time of the incident that day.
u00a0
Shortly after his arrest, Shiney's wife Anupam had rushed to his defence and declared that he neither smoked nor consumed alcohol. The two latest reports could seriously blunt the actor's self-defence.
u00a0
On June 14, Shiney's domestic help had lodged a police complaint alleging rape by the actor.
u00a0
After his arrest, he was shunted to police custody and is presently in judicial custody till July 2 (Thursday).
u00a0
If the charges against him are proved in court, Shiney faces a minimum seven-year jail sentence.
u00a0
A team of the National Commission of Women (NCW) rushed to Mumbai and met all the concerned parties, including the victim and her family members.
u00a0
Following the NCW visit, Chief Minister Ashok Chavan had announced that the Shiney rape case would be transferred to a fast track court soon.
